group 2 existing functions in the area
Problems: -people don’t go outside –WHY? -unpleasant streets –too wide -not enough functions for
pedestrians -scale- too big -not sufficient density -too formal -impersonal -segregation of functions -autonomous buildings -public transport- why is not used more? -people commute
Main intention/purpose: People to use the outside space!
Ways to achieve it: -new functions -make the scale more human -make a network of attractions -make better connections
Place where we want to intervene: The European District North
